Join a fun evening celebrating women's print media with Glasgow Women’s Library!

To continue the celebration of The Women’s Library's 100th anniversary, Glasgow Women’s Library will be taking up residence at LSE Library for one evening to create your own 2027 Feminist Diary, inspired by the rich history of feminist magazines, posters, postcards, and activist print culture.

In this relaxed, hands-on workshop, you'll use scrapbooking and collage techniques to transform a plain diary into a beautiful and personal keepsake. Using a variety of papers, images, quotes, decorative materials, and mixed-media craft supplies, you'll layer, cut, arrange, and decorate pages that reflect your creativity, interests, and values.

Throughout the workshop, you'll explore inspiring feminist messages and imagery, weaving them throughout your diary so they can be discovered as you use it during the year - offering moments of motivation, reflection, and encouragement.

No previous craft experience is needed. Whether you use your diary to capture ideas, dreams, plans, or everyday notes, you'll leave with a unique and practical journal that celebrates feminist history while inspiring your own journey through 2027

Women’s journals, magazines and newsletters document women’s lives through the ages. The LSE Library collection includes our earliest titles from the 18th century. Many titles disseminated women’s political ideas and illustrated the development of the publishing industry for women’s popular magazines from the 19th century onwards. LSE Library also holds journals relating to campaigning and feminist groups in addition to those of professional and voluntary organisations. We will use this material to inspire and make our own creations!

Glasgow Women’s Library is the only Accredited Museum in the UK dedicated to women’s lives, histories and achievements, with a lending library, archive collections and innovative programmes of public events & learning opportunities.
